患有急性白血病的患者中CD标志物的异常表达

概括
这项研究发现,伊拉克白血病患者的异常分化集群 (CD) 标志物表达率高. 鉴定这些异常抗原的免疫类型对于诊断白血病至关重要.

研究的目的:
- 评估伊拉克白血病 (AL) 患者异常分化集群 (CD) 标记表达的患病率.
- 在新诊断的白血病患者中分析CD标记物表达.
- 为了将免疫表型特征与白血病亚型相关联.
主要方法:
- 包括175名新诊断的白血病患者 (110名男性,65名女性;年龄为1-85岁).
- 骨髓吸收和流动细胞测量用于CD标志物分析.
- 血液学参数,免疫类型特征和人口统计数据的统计分析.
主要成果:
- 鉴定出了CD13,CD19,CD33,CD34,CD117,CD56,CD5,TdT,HLA-DR和CD79a的异常表达方式.
- 急性髓性白血病 (AML) 是最常见的亚型 (46.2%),其次是B级急性淋巴细胞白血病 (B-ALL) (26.2%) 和T级急性淋巴细胞白血病 (T-ALL) (8.5%).
- CD34在AML,B-ALL和T-ALL中表达高;CD13和CD33在AML中占主导地位;CD56和CD117与多发性髓瘤 (MM) 有关.
结论:
- 在白血病病例中观察到高比例的异常CD标志物表达.
- 免疫类型定型有助于白血病诊断和瘤细胞与正常细胞的分化.
- 这些发现与全球关于白血病异常抗原表达的数据一致.

Acute respiratory failure is a condition characterized by the inability of the lungs to perform their primary function: gas exchange. This failure leads to insufficient oxygen levels (hypoxemia) in the blood, elevated carbon dioxide levels (hypercapnia), or both, causing critical impairment in organ function.

Type I Respiratory Failure, or hypoxemic respiratory failure, occurs when the partial pressure of oxygen (PaO2) in arterial blood falls below 60 mmHg while breathing room air without a corresponding increase in arterial carbon dioxide levels (PaCO2). This condition highlights a significant impairment in the lungs' capacity to oxygenate the blood.
